Top 3 Sandwich Shops in New Orleans

  1. 1

    Central Grocery and Deli

    French Quarter

    McNulty: the 1906 Italian deli that invented the muffuletta — "like an antipasto platter crossed with a sandwich" — reopened December 2024 after Hurricane Ida.

  2. 2

    Turkey and the Wolf

    Irish Channel

    Gambit review: Mason Hereford's fried-bologna tower means "one cannot eat this sandwich without grinning like a silly teenager."

  3. 3

    Stein's Market and Deli

    Lower Garden District

    McNulty for Gambit: Dan Stein's Jewish/Italian deli is "the place in New Orleans" for hoagies — cheesesteak specials and roast-pork-with-broccoli-rabe on house-made ciabatta.
